Abstract

conference 4944 " Integrated Optical Devices: Fabrication and Testing ", session 1 " Microcavities and Photonic Crystals [4944-4]; International audience; A new kind of Erbium doped heavy fluoride glass Er:ZBLALiP has been studied. Microspheres were fabricated with this fluoride glass. Whispering Gallery Mode laser spectra around 1550 nm were analyzed for different sphere diameters and Erbium concentrations (from 0.01% to 0.2% by mole) under pumping by a fiber taper at 1480 nm. Red-shift effect on the frequencies of both fluorescence and laser spectra is experimentally observed when the pump power is increased, originating from thermal effects. A spectroscopic technique based on the green upconversion fluorescence is used to compute a loading effective temperature for the Er:ZBLALiP microsphere and this further allows us to calibrate the properties of the microsphere laser in terms of the thermal expansion as well as the variation of the refractive index.
